Transaction 084bccda19e916140a65689d21438bca9624d5090d2098739efc816658f52918

1 Input
2 Outputs
  • 084bccda19e916140a65689d21438bca9624d5090d2098739efc816658f52918:0
  • value  1564
    address  18S45Eorgh8UBcUuny9uM8XoR1YNW2RCJu
  • 084bccda19e916140a65689d21438bca9624d5090d2098739efc816658f52918:1
  • value  154824
    address  3MBbKTbcN72RNDMwoBtaP9QtKWcmiVfM3X